List of cities in Sao Tome and Principe
This is a list of cities in Sao Tome and Principe .
By far the largest agglomeration in São Tomé and Príncipe is São Tomé with a population of 62,174 (as of January 1, 2005). This means that around 40 percent of the country's population is concentrated in the capital region.
The following table lists the cities with more than 2000 inhabitants, the results of the census of August 4, 1991, August 25, 2001 and May 13, 2012 as well as the district to which the city belongs. The population figures refer to the actual city without the suburbs.
Cities in Sao Tome and Principe | |||||
rank | city | Residents | District | ||
1991 census | 2001 census | 2012 census | |||
1. | Sao Tome | 42,331 | 49,957 | 67,000 | Água Grande |
2. | Trindade | k. A. | 6,049 | 16,140 | Mé-Zóchi |
3. | Santana | 6,190 | 6.228 | 10,290 | Cantagalo |
4th | Neves | 5,919 | 6,635 | 10,068 | Lembá |
5. | Guadalupe | k. A. | 1,543 | 7,604 | Lobata |
6th | Santo Amaro | 5,878 | k. A. | k. A. | Lobata |
7th | Santo António | 1,000 | 1.010 | 2,620 | Pagué |
8th. | Pantufo | k. A. | 1.929 | 2,500 | Água Grande |
